Lanivet comes out at 43/100 on the 9 categories we can score here. Broadband is where Lanivet most outperforms the national norm: 97/100 against a median of 60/100 across UK towns. Furthest below the national norm is bills, at 24/100 against a town median of 47/100.

That is the highest score of the 7 places in the PL30 postcode district. Its categories are unusually uneven: 92 points separate broadband (97) from healthcare (5), a wider spread than about nine in ten UK towns. The PL30 district averages 36/100, putting Lanivet 7 points above its own postcode area. Wider context for the surrounding area: PL30 postcode district.

House Prices

Not enough recent sales

Fewer than 10 sales were recorded in Lanivet in the last 12 months, which isn't enough for a reliable median. Smaller villages often fall below this in any given year. Figures come from HM Land Registry Price Paid data and are updated monthly, so this may fill in later.
